Patent map creation method and efficient patent search/analysis methods and practices for engineers and researchers

When it comes to patent mapping, researchers and engineers often seek efficient methods for creating and analyzing patent maps.
Patent maps are essential tools that provide a visual representation of a landscape of specific technologies.
They allow professionals to identify trends, competitors, and potential areas for innovation.
Let’s explore the methods and practices involved in creating and analyzing patent maps efficiently.

Understanding the Basics of Patent Mapping

Patent mapping is a process that involves collecting, organizing, and visually representing patent data.
This visualization helps researchers and engineers to understand the technological and competitive landscape.
Patent maps can cover a variety of information, including the distribution of patents over time, geographies, and areas of technology.

Creating a patent map starts with gathering data from patent databases like the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) or the European Patent Office (EPO).
Once the data is collected, it must be categorized based on various parameters such as assignees, inventors, and priority dates.
Visualization tools are then used to transform this data into a map that highlights these parameters and trends.

Effective Methods for Creating Patent Maps

Selecting the Right Tools

The first step in creating an efficient patent map is selecting the right tools.
Several software solutions offer patent mapping features that enable users to create comprehensive visualizations.
Some popular choices include Innography, Derwent Innovation, and PatSnap.
These tools offer various functionalities, such as keyword searches, data filtering, and visual representation features, which are essential for effective patent analysis.

Keyword and Boolean Searches

Efficient patent mapping starts with an effective search strategy.
Identifying relevant keywords and using Boolean search techniques can significantly streamline the process.
Boolean searches use operators like AND, OR, and NOT, which help in refining search results and narrowing down the focus to specific areas of interest.
This method ensures that engineers and researchers retrieve a precise selection of patents related to their study area.

Data Categorization and Clustering

Once patent data is gathered, it is crucial to categorize and cluster this information meaningfully.
Categorization can be based on industries, technologies, companies, or patent citation data.
Clustering involves grouping patents with similar characteristics, which uncovers trends and patterns.
This practice allows for a more focused analysis and helps prioritize areas requiring deeper investigation.

Practices for Efficient Patent Search and Analysis

Benchmarking Against Competitors

A significant part of patent search and analysis involves benchmarking against competitors.
Analyze your competitors’ patent portfolios to identify their strengths and weaknesses.
This practice reveals gaps in their portfolios and can highlight potential opportunities for innovation or collaboration.
Moreover, understanding your competitors’ patenting activities can guide strategic planning and decision-making processes.

Keeping Track of Technological Trends

Patent analysis also involves staying up-to-date with technological trends within a specific domain.
Regularly updating patent maps ensures that engineers and researchers remain informed about emerging technologies and shifts in the industry.
Tracking these trends enables proactive decision-making and early identification of disruptive innovations that may impact your field.

Utilizing Cross-Referencing Techniques

Cross-referencing patents with related academic papers, research articles, or other patents can enrich the analysis process.
This technique helps in understanding the practical applications of patented technologies and their relevance within the broader industry.
By doing so, researchers and engineers can identify potential collaborative research opportunities and development projects.

Best Practices for Effective Analysis and Insights

Visualization and Presentation

An effective patent map should be easy to interpret and visually appealing.
Utilize charts, graphs, and heat maps to simplify complex data and highlight significant patterns or trends.
Visualization tools within patent mapping software can convert dense data into digestible formats, making it easier for team members and stakeholders to comprehend and make informed decisions.

Focusing on Quality over Quantity

When conducting patent analysis, it’s important to focus on the quality of patents, not just their quantity.
Emphasize analyzing valuable patents with practical applications, strong claims, and potential for commercialization.
This approach keeps the analysis focused and ensures that the insights derived from the patent map align with the strategic objectives of your organization.

Continuous Learning and Adaptation

Patent mapping is not a one-time activity but a continuous process of learning and adaptation.
Ensure continuous monitoring of patent landscapes to keep abreast of any changes or new entries in the market.
Adapting your patent analysis strategies based on the latest data and trends will ensure that your organization remains competitive and innovative.
